It is compulsory for all companies doing business with the U.S. Government valued over $30,000 to register on a website called “SAM – System for Award Management” www.sam.gov.

The website compiles standard information such as the company legal name, street address, contact information, and what kind of goods and services it offers. An NCAGE code is required to register in SAM. If you do not have this information, it must be obtained before registering. There is no cost involved, neither to obtaining the NCAGE code nor to register in SAM.
